In the UK do I have to have a smart meter for my business?

In the UK, businesses are not legally required to have a smart meter, but energy suppliers are obligated to offer them under the Smart Meter Installation Code of Practice (SMICoP). Benefits of Non-Capex Solar in the UK

Non-capex solar deals in the UK, such as Power Purchase Agreements (PPAs), leasing, or solar-as-a-service models, offer several benefits to businesses, public sector organisations, and even homeowners. These arrangements allow customers to adopt solar energy without upfront capital expenditure (capex).
